Ontario's new Premier is named Kathleen Wynne and sadly she has stated that supports the Liberal Party Line that brought in BSL.
Here is a recent response from our new premier on a
letter just recently sent. NOTE that she refers to her and her partner
having two dogs at one time.
Dear Name withheld due to request.
Thank you very much for writing me, and taking the time to participate
in this important conversation.
Molly and Buster, our “twins”, were fantastic companions. I truly
enjoyed all of the privileges of being a pet owner - the unconditional love,
the greetings after a hard day’s work and the daily walks. I also
enjoyed the responsibilities of pet ownership, and that included ensuring that
our dogs were well trained and didn’t pose a risk to public safety.
Ontario Liberals made the decision to restrict pit bulls. After a series
of horrific accidents around the province, we decided that the interests of
public safety would be best-served by restricting that particular breed.
My position is that repealing this legislation would be a step backwards.
I hear your concern and I know that this legislation has presented
challenges for some dog owners, but I believe that all Ontarians want what is
in the best interests of public safety.
